2021年7月9日 星期五

[研究][ASP.NET]錯誤 CS1026 必須是 )

[研究][ASP.NET]錯誤 CS1026 必須是 )

2021-07-09



嚴重性 程式碼 說明 專案 檔案 隱藏項目狀態

錯誤 CS1026 必須是 ) 26_Events_Detail.aspx D:\Code\Solution1\WebApplication1\Events_Detail.aspx 30 作用中

********************************************************************************

解決


<asp:HyperLink ID="HyperLink2" CssClass='<%#(String.IsNullOrEmpty(Eval("prev_id").ToString())?"next disable":"next")%>' title="下一篇" runat="server" Text="Next" NavigateUrl='<%# String.Format("~/Detail.aspx?lang={0}&amp;seq={1}", Request["language"], Eval("prev_id")) %>'></asp:HyperLink>


適度的換行,改成如下
 

<asp:HyperLink ID="HyperLink2" CssClass='<%#(String.IsNullOrEmpty(Eval("prev_id").ToString())?"next disable":"next")%>' title="下一篇" runat="server" Text="Next" NavigateUrl='<%# String.Format("~/Detail.aspx?lang={0}&amp;seq={1}", 
                                Request["language"], 
                                Eval("prev_id")) 
                                %>'></asp:HyperLink>


Compile 正常了。

有點懷疑是 Compiler 的誤判 Bug。

(完) 


沒有留言:

張貼留言